Czeslaw Nemen (1939 - 2004) - Polish rock and the folk musician, the singer, the poet, the artist. The Author of songs, the vocalist and the multi-instrumentalist Czeslaw Nemen – one of the most popular, original and influential actors in the Polish music of the 20th century combined in the creativity musical trends of progressive rock
. Having begun with rather simple things in genres of bottoms and a soul, it quickly switched to more complex compositions including elements of jazz and vanguard.
Also, being a charismatic and gifted vocalist, the musician was also one of pioneers of the Polish electronics.
Czeslaw Nemen (polsk. Czeslaw Niemen; real name Czeslaw Yuliush Vydzhitsky, polsk. Czeslaw Juliusz Wydrzycki; On February 16, 1939, the village Old Vasilishki, nowadays Shchuchinsky district of the Grodno region of Belarus — on January 17, 2004, Warsaw, Poland) — the Polish composer, the arranger, the singer. Representative of the movement progressive rock.
After successful participation in competitions of amateur performers began to play with Niebiesko-Czarni ensemble. Together with it in "Niebiesko-Czarni" also other legendary Polish performers acted. Eto Wojciech Korda, Ada Rusovich, Andrzej Nebeski and Helena Maydanets.
Is known as the brightest representative of the European progressive rock,
performer of spiritual poetry (composed music on verses by Ts. Norvid),
experiments in the field of electronic music much (an album "Catharsis", 1976).

Józef Zakhariash Bem (1794-1850) is the Polish military leader of the 19th century. In 1812-1814
battled as a part of troops of the Duchy Warsaw, allied to Napoleon, against Russia
and other troops of the anti-Napoleonic coalition. With transformation following the results of the Napoleonic wars of the Duchy Warsaw to the Kingdom Polish under the auspices of Alexander I, continued service in his troops. Kogda the Polish revolt of 1830 broke out, adjoined insurgents, with its defeat emigrated. Participated in different European campaigns. During the Hungarian revolution 1848-49gg. ordered the Hungarian revolutionary army in Transylvania, it was broken by the Russian troops, fled to Turkey. There accepted Islam and under the name of Amurat-pashi it is appointed the Ottoman padishah the governor of Aleppo (nowadays Aleppo in Syria) where died in 1850.
Tsiprian Norvid (1821-1883) is the Polish poet romantic. The emigrant, died in Paris in poverty.
